On 04.06.2007 07:21, Bill Nottingham wrote:
> Thorsten Leemhuis (fedora at leemhuis.info) said:
>> Rough Example: Ship test3; get the tree release-ready for two or three
>> weeks later. Create the release directories on the servers and issue a
>> RC from them with ISOs. Spread them; if important bugs are found: Fix
>> them in a rolling release scheme. One or two weeks later issue the real
>> release and freeze the repos; all updates from now on get into the
>> update repo.
> Seems disruptive from a mirror standpoint
Why precisely?
The files in the release dir could simply be hardlinked to rawhide when
the release directories gets created for the first time. Then the mirror
should get them in some minutes without much pain.
